mazur (05.11.2010 18:52, просмотров: 177) ответил Скрипач на А что останется от клавиатуры если "дребезг отбросим"? Читай порт и все.
Убиться головой ап стену. Никто не может объяснить, почему некоторые говорят, что таймер вешать на каждую кнопу. Неужели мы мыслим абсолютно по разному. Ладно я не мог вас первое время понять. Это объяснимо. Я не говорю что я стал шибко грамотным, но и той малости тогда не знал.
Делаем сканирование кнопок, какие бы они не были, и как бы не были разбросаны по портам. Неважно каким способом формируем слово (скан-код, или как-то еще обозвать). Сравниваем предыдущее и текущее состояние. Если не равно, сохраняем текущий результат. Включаем задержку на подавление дребезга. В следующий раз, если то изменение истинно, считается изменением и обрабатывается как должно. Как будто это одна кнопа.
Возможно мы пока друг друга не понимаем, потому что я исхожу из своих потребностей. И не реализовал другие способы. Вот и хотелось бы ясности.